Options
Put spread on the CBOE Volatility Index (VIX). Entered at a net debit of $0.04 on 7/28/2025; expired worthless on 8/22/2025. Loss: 100%.
Puts on Invesco QQQ Trust (QQQ 1.36%↑). Bought for $2.27 on 7/14/2025; expired worthless on 8/22/2025. Loss: 100%.
Put spread on BlackSky Technology (BKSY 7.81%↑). Entered at a net credit of $2.09 on 7/25/2025; exited at a net debit of $4 on 8/22/2025. Loss: 91%.
Put spread on Applied Digital (APLD 4.61%↑). Entered at a net credit of $0.33 as part of a 4-leg combo on 8/18/2025; exited (half) at a net debit of $0.20 on 8/22/2025. Profit: 39%1.
Call spread on Futu Holdings (FUTU -2.24%↓). Entered at a net debit of $5.15 on 7/15/2025; exited at a net credit of $14 on 8/18/2025. Profit: 172%.
Calls on UP Fintech Holding Ltd (TIGR 9.21%↑). Bought for $1.10 on 6/9/2025; sold for $3.30 on 8/22/2025. Profit: 200%.
39% on net credit; 19% on max risk.

Options
Exit #1 here was a lotto ticket bet on volatility collapsing over the next month, which didn’t happen.
Exit #2, the Invesco QQQ Trust (QQQ 1.36%↑) puts, were a hedge against a market collapse that didn’t happen (and we didn’t expect to happen, just wanted to insure against). We used the Portfolio Armor iPhone app to scan for those, and will do so again soon.
Exit #3, was a bullish bet on BlackSky Technology (BKSY 7.81%↑). Military tech stocks seem to have suffered recently, thanks to President Trump’s peacemaking efforts.
Exits #5 and #6, Futu Holdings (FUTU -2.24%↓) and UP Fintech Holding Ltd (TIGR 9.21%↑), were on Greater China brokerage/fintech names. We added a new bullish trade on TIGR earlier this week.
